**Alert: Rate-parity checker lagging**

Heads up — the Tidewell rate-parity checker fell behind during last night's crawl and is now comparing stale prices for roughly 1,200 properties in the Verlanne region. That means parity-violation alerts going to partners may be bogus until the backlog clears, so hold the notification release until we confirm freshness. ETA to catch up is about four hours. Backlog status, crawl progress, and the manual requeue steps are tracked on the page below.

wiki page, tahaf-tajog: https://jira.ordindyn.corp/pipeline

Hello plugin authors,

Next Thursday, Corbexa will run a disaster-recovery drill for the RestockRoute vending-machine restock planner. During the failover window, plugin callbacks will be replayed against the standby scheduler, so please ensure your handlers are idempotent and tolerate duplicate route assignments. No customer restock data will be altered. To re-register your plugin against the standby environment during the drill, authenticate with the recovery passphrase provided below.

vault phrase of hahip-tajeg = quenax-briath-briax

# Who to Contact — StockTrue Reconciliation Job

New here? Welcome. The nightly StockTrue job compares warehouse counts against the ledger and files discrepancy reports around 03:00. If the job fails outright, the Batch Ops group owns the scheduler and will usually rerun it for you. If it succeeds but the numbers look wild (think thousands of phantom units), that's a data problem, not a job problem — loop in the inventory data stewards at Marlow Goods. For either case, start by emailing the reconciliation team.

billing contact of hahig-yajop = fraael_fraox@nelvrocorp.internal

## Runbook: Stormbell Fan-Out

Welcome aboard. The Stormbell service fans weather alerts out to regional relays within five seconds of ingest. If relays stall, first verify the publisher process can authenticate to the Gustwire message bus — most stalls trace back to a rotated credential that wasn't redeployed. Check /opt/stormbell/.env; the bus credential is set on the line directly below this point.

sealed setting: ARCHIVE_KEY3=8d0